Mining News. KARANG AH AK E. [From our own Correspondent.]

Kauangahape, Saturday. Ivan Hop Battery t A parcel of ore from the old Mammoth claim has just been cleaned up at this Battery (for Mr J. I^iddell), but I am sorry to say the result is not up to expectations, it proving barely payable. White and party (tributers, Ivanhoe s*nd Truro), have a good sized parcel in the Mill, crushing of which will be startei to-day. Chris tchui'ch Co.'s Battery: This plant is kept steadily going on quarlz from the Co.'s mine, bpt whether payable or otherwise, I am unable to ascertain. ICenil worth : (Moore's Tribute) : This party have a considerably tonagp of ore broken out, but I learn that the block is almost exhausted. Shepherd's Tribute : A largp parcel of very rich ore is being carted from this tribute section to the Oassel Company's plant, Jvarangahnke, where it will be furnaced and put through the dry crusher, it is expected to turn out richer than the parcol o.f forty tons sold to, Mr H. C Wick, sometime ago, which averaged by a.ssay over LIOO person. Adeline Amalgamated : I hear that there is a likelihood pf this Company starting operations again. Very little work has been done in any part of the large area whiph is held by this Company, ul though they own some of the best ground in the distiict. Imperial : In this mine a gp.od si^ed reel' is bo ing driven on, which prospects very well.

Gorge lloa.l: The contractors (Messrs Kelly and Polton), are making capital Imadway with, this work, the road being now formed to the bhiif on the township end, besides a good many chains of earthwork completed ou the Halm side. It is expected to bo open for traffic by Christmas, New School : Romp time ago the residents of Kaniniruhaktt petitioned the Board of Education for a full-time school, and off ei ing a contiibutiori of L 25 The offer was, accepted, and the money hav-'n^- lu'lmi j>aid over to the Board, tenders will be invited for the erection of building in the course of 11 few days.
